About the Hogwarts Monthly:


The Hogwarts Monthly was created many years ago as the guild's official newsletter. Over the years, the writers, editors, and ideas of the Hogwarts Monthly have changed, representing the progress and growth of Harry Potter Guild of Gaia since 2005. After a long hiatus, the Hogwarts Monthly began running again in 2009. Without the readers and writers that burst with ideas, the Hogwarts Monthly would never exist. Each issue is intended for the entertainment of the members of HPGoG, and is therefore sustained by the members of HPGoG.

All normal issues of the Hogwarts Monthly will be posted by the HogwartsMonthlyEditor in the Hogwarts Monthly thread.
Please note that the HogwartsMonthlyEditor is an official guild mule. It is used only by the current editor and Heads of House when necessary.
All submissions are original works of the members of Harry Potter Guild of Gaia, so please do not copy anyone else's work. That is plagarism. Any references to particular people have been approved by said person. In other cases, no harm was intended because the Hogwarts Monthly is strictly PG-rated. All concerns can be addressed to the Editor, a moderator, or Professor Adonis.

The Current Guidelines for each Monthly:
(for those who want to read it, the text is in white)


1. The Headline should always be the first post of the Monthly. The Current Staff should always be listed in the last post of the Monthly, along with Acknowledgments for Special Contributors.

2. Each article should have the contributors' names posted in the article at the top or in the bottom right corner of the article.

3. Must always have a Special Announcements Section (to include other guild announcements) and a Note From the Editor Section (that section can be anything the Editor wants, even nothing).

4. The monthly need only be about 12 posts/pages. It can be less, but try not to make it more so that it always fits on the first page.

5. Member(s) of the month are chosen by the Mod Squad. Only exceptions should be announced by Professor Adonis AHEAD of time.

6. The Hogwarts Monthly is posted at the BEGINNING (not the end) of every month. It should be published the first day of every month, if more time is needed please make sure the Mod Squad knows. Otherwise it's not a good look.

7. Only the Editor (or a moderator) can add points to the Hour Glasses for Monthly submissions.
